Think your Mac is powerful now? This practical guide shows you how to get much more from your system by tapping into Unix, the robust operating system concealed beneath OS Xs beautiful user interface. OS X puts more than a thousand Unix commands at your fingertipsfor finding and managing files, remotely accessing your Mac from other computers, and using freely downloadable open source applications.If youre an experienced Mac user, this updated edition teaches you all the basic commands you need to get started with Unix. Youll soon learn how to gain real control over your system.Get your Mac to do exactly what you want, when you want Make changes to your Macs filesystem and directories Use Unixs find, locate, and grep commands to locate files containing specific information Create unique "super commands" to perform tasks that you specify Run multiple Unix programs and processes at the same time Access remote servers and interact with remote filesystems Install the X Window system and learn the best X11 applications Take advantage of command-line features that let you shorten repetitive tasks
